Key Features
- Core: The MCU is built around a 32-bit ColdFire V2 core that offers a maximum CPU frequency of 66 MHz, providing a solid foundation for both simple and complex tasks.
- Memory: It comes equipped with 256 KB of flash memory and 32 KB of SRAM, allowing for ample space for code and data storage.
- Communication Interfaces: To ensure versatile connectivity, the MCF52100CEP66 includes multiple communication interfaces such as UART, I²C, SPI, and CAN, enabling easy integration with a wide range of peripherals and networks.
- Timers and Counters: The device features robust timing and control capabilities with its multiple general-purpose timers, PWM modules, and a real-time clock for scheduling and time-sensitive operations.
- Analog-to-Digital Converter (ADC): An integrated 12-bit ADC allows the MCU to interface with analog sensors and transducers, making it suitable for data acquisition and control systems.
- Package: The MCF52100CEP66 is available in a 64-pin LQFP package, which is both space-saving and convenient for PCB design.
